GOAL: |
Spiritual awakening
of families in the Archdiocese of
Ernakulam-Angamaly in the Year of Family 2006
|
|
OBJECTIVES: |
|
1. |
Find out the impact
of modern sociological trends and changes in the
family |
|
2. |
Assess the pastoral
needs of the family today |
|
3. |
Plan and execute
more target oriented programmes through
different Departments and Apostolates in the
Archdiocese |
|
4. |
Help the
Archdiocese and parishes to address the
challenges that threaten the families today |
|
5. |
Evaluate the
effects of activities of different Departments
in the Archdiocese
|
|
BENEFICIARIES & BENEFITS: |
|
Archdiocese in general: |
 |
The Archdiocese can
formulate pastoral policies and chart out
programmes during this Family Year and after,
based on the findings of the survey |
 |
Clarity on modern
trends regarding:
-
Different status in
family life such as singles, separated, widow/ers
etc.
-
Couples of
different age groups
-
Strength and
weakness in the number of different
professionals and how their expertise and
services can be utilized in the pastoral field
-
Number of faithful
migrated abroad and elsewhere in India for job
-
Increase/decrease
in the number of those going out for studies
etc.
-
Children of
different age groups, how do the total numbers
vary as time goes
-
Number of unmarried
girls and boys even after the age of marriage
|
 |
Complete data on
the priests and religious who hail from but work
outside the Archdiocese |
 |
Comprehensive
statistics for the Archdiocesan Directory |
 |
Changing trends
will evoke further studies in various directions
so as to get more clarity on where the
Archdiocese is heading. |
